Bendekayi chutney| Ladies finger chutney | Bhindi chutney | Chutney for dosa

Okra chutney is a simple, lip smacking recipe. Easy to make and tastes delicious. This okra chutney goes well with chapati, roti, dosa and even good with hot steamed rice also.

Ingredients

  • 2 Okara/Bhindi chopped, use soft, tender okra
  • 1/2 green chilli
  • 1/2 cup grated coconut
  • 1 tbsp fried gram
  • 2 to 3 ginger slices
  • 2 to 3 coriander leaves with stem
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 2 tsp coconut oil
  • 1/2 tsp mustard
  • 1/2 tsp cumin
  • 1/2 tsp hing (asafoetida)
  • 3 curry leaves

Instructions

How to make Okra/ Bhindi chutney:

  • Heat a small frying pan over low to medium flame and add coconut oil.
  • Once the oil gets heated, add green chilli and chopped okra. While using okra make sure that, it should be soft and tender.
  • Saute for 2 to 3 mins and turn off the heat. Allow this to cool completely.
  • Now transfer this to a blender.
  • Also add grated coconut, fried gram, ginger slices and coriander leaves along with its stem.
  • Similarly add salt and little water.
  • Grind this to a fine paste and transfer this mixture to a bowl. keep it aside. Mean while we prepare the tempering for chutney.
  • Heat a tempering ladle and add little coconut oil. 
  • Once the oil is enough heated, add mustard, cumin, hing and curry leaves.
  • Saute well until it splutters and turn off the heat.
  • Then transfer this tempering to the prepared okra chutney and give it a good mix.
  • Now the lip smacking okra chutney is ready to serve!
  • Serve this okra chutney as a side dish with chapati, roti, dosa and even good with hot rice also.
